What Is Stinging Nettle and How Can It Help with Hair Loss?
Stinging nettle is a flowering plant known for its potential benefits in treating hair loss. Its scientific name is Urtica dioica, and it possesses anti-inflammatory properties and nutrients that may support hair health.
The National Center for Complementary and Integrative Health recognizes stinging nettle for its medicinal uses, noting its historical applications in herbal remedies.
Stinging nettle contains vitamins A, C, K, and several B vitamins. It also has minerals like iron, calcium, and magnesium. The plant is thought to improve circulation to the scalp and inhibit the production of dihydrotestosterone (DHT), a hormone associated with hair loss.
According to Healthline, stinging nettle may be beneficial for conditions like androgenetic alopecia, where hair follicles shrink over time. Hair loss can stem from various factors, including genetics, hormonal changes, and nutritional deficiencies.
The American Hair Loss Association states that approximately 50 million men and 30 million women in the U.S. experience hair loss. This condition affects millions globally and is projected to increase as the population ages.
Hair loss can impact self-esteem and social interactions, leading to anxiety or depression for some individuals. Societally, it may contribute to the demand for cosmetic products and hair restoration services.
Stinging nettle is often incorporated into hair care products, such as shampoos and conditioners, to promote hair growth. Recommendations include using stinging nettle extracts or supplements formulated for hair health.
Natural hair remedies like stinging nettle tea, topical applications of nettle oil, and balanced nutrition can diminish hair loss risk. Experts advise combining these methods with a healthy lifestyle to enhance overall hair vitality.
What Key Ingredients Should You Seek in Stinging Nettle Shampoo for Enhanced Hair Growth?
To enhance hair growth with stinging nettle shampoo, seek key ingredients such as vitamins, minerals, and natural extracts that promote scalp health and stimulate hair follicles.
- Vitamins (e.g., Vitamin A, B Vitamins, Vitamin E)
- Minerals (e.g., Zinc, Iron, Magnesium)
- Essential fatty acids (e.g., Omega-3, Omega-6)
- Herbal extracts (e.g., rosemary, peppermint, and tea tree oil)
- Protein sources (e.g., hydrolyzed keratin, wheat protein)
These ingredients play varied and significant roles in hair care. Now, let’s explore each in detail.
-
Vitamins: Vitamins in stinging nettle shampoo, such as Vitamin A and B Vitamins, are essential for promoting healthy hair growth. Vitamin A supports cell production and ensures a healthy scalp. B vitamins, particularly Biotin, are crucial for hair strength. A deficiency in Biotin can lead to hair loss, making its inclusion in shampoos important for enhancing hair volume and thickness.
-
Minerals: Minerals like Zinc and Iron are vital for hair health. Zinc improves hair tissue growth and repair, while Iron assists in oxygen transport to hair follicles. An iron deficiency can lead to hair thinning and loss. A 2016 study by N. M. H. Ali et al. highlighted that individuals with hair loss often have lower serum iron levels, indicating the importance of these minerals in hair care.
-
Essential Fatty Acids: Essential fatty acids such as Omega-3 and Omega-6 help maintain hair’s natural luster and elasticity. They support scalp health by reducing inflammation and promoting moisture retention. Research in the journal Nutrition (2015) by H. K. Trüeb showed that supplementation with Omega-3 can reduce hair loss and improve scalp condition, making them a worthy addition in shampoo formulations.
-
Herbal Extracts: Herbal extracts like rosemary and tea tree oil have been linked to stimulating hair growth and improving scalp health. Rosemary oil is known for increasing circulation to the scalp, which can enhance hair growth, while tea tree oil offers antibacterial properties that help maintain a clean scalp. A study published in Eureka Reviews (2017) demonstrated that rosemary oil is as effective as minoxidil, a standard hair loss treatment.
-
Protein Sources: Protein sources such as hydrolyzed keratin are crucial in restoring hair’s strength and structure. Keratin is a natural protein in hair, and its incorporation in shampoo helps repair damaged strands. A 2020 article in Journal of Cosmetic Dermatology reviewed studies showing that hydrolyzed proteins enhance hair elasticity and reduce breakage, underscoring their importance in hair care formulations.
What Are the Proven Benefits of Using Stinging Nettle Shampoo on Thinning Hair?
The proven benefits of using stinging nettle shampoo on thinning hair include improved hair growth, enhanced scalp health, and reduced hair loss.
- Improved Hair Growth
- Enhanced Scalp Health
- Reduced Hair Loss
- Natural Ingredients
- Anti-Inflammatory Properties
- Nutrient-Rich Composition
- Varied User Experiences
The benefits of stinging nettle shampoo can vary based on individual experiences and perceptions. Some users report significant improvements, while others may find the results less dramatic. User experiences also differ based on hair type and overall health, indicating that while stinging nettle can be beneficial, it may not be a one-size-fits-all solution.
-
Improved Hair Growth: The benefit of improved hair growth with stinging nettle shampoo arises from its rich nutrient profile. Stinging nettle contains vitamins A, C, K, and B vitamins, including biotin, which are essential for healthy hair. The American Hair Loss Association notes that biotin can help promote thicker hair. Research by Prakash et al. (2013) supports the idea that nettle extract can stimulate hair follicles, potentially leading to new hair growth.
-
Enhanced Scalp Health: Stinging nettle shampoo promotes enhanced scalp health by providing anti-fungal and antibacterial properties. Nettle is recognized for its potential to alleviate dandruff and other scalp irritations. According to a study published in the International Journal of Trichology (2015), maintaining a healthy scalp environment is crucial for preventing hair loss, making nettle beneficial for scalp conditions.
-
Reduced Hair Loss: The reduction of hair loss is another key advantage of stinging nettle shampoo, attributed to its ability to block dihydrotestosterone (DHT). DHT is a hormone linked to hair loss. As noted in a study by J. M. Huber and colleagues (2017), nettle’s natural DHT-blocking abilities can help maintain hair density and prevent premature thinning, especially in men experiencing androgenetic alopecia.
-
Natural Ingredients: Stinging nettle shampoo offers the advantage of containing natural ingredients. Many commercial hair loss products use harsh chemicals that may damage hair and scalp health. Organic products like stinging nettle shampoo provide a gentler alternative while still delivering effective results.
-
Anti-Inflammatory Properties: The anti-inflammatory properties of stinging nettle can reduce inflammation in the scalp. This can help combat conditions like psoriasis or scalp acne, which contribute to hair thinning. A study published in the Journal of Ethnopharmacology (2012) highlighted that the anti-inflammatory effects of nettle make it beneficial for soothing irritated scalps.
-
Nutrient-Rich Composition: Stinging nettle shampoo is nutrient-rich, containing essential minerals such as iron, magnesium, and zinc. These nutrients are vital for maintaining healthy hair and preventing breakage. Research reviewed by Zille et al. (2018) emphasizes the importance of minerals in the hair growth cycle.
-
Varied User Experiences: User experiences with stinging nettle shampoo can vary significantly. Some individuals may see rapid improvements in hair volume and growth, while others may take longer to notice results. Factors such as genetics, overall health, and hair care routines can influence effectiveness. Personal testimonials often reflect both success stories and instances of minimal improvement, suggesting that while stinging nettle can be beneficial, results are subjective.

How Can You Effectively Use Stinging Nettle Shampoo in Your Daily Hair Care Routine?
You can effectively use stinging nettle shampoo in your daily hair care routine by following specific steps that enhance hair health and promote scalp well-being.
-
Choose the right product: Select a stinging nettle shampoo that contains natural ingredients. Look for products labeled as free from sulfates and parabens, as these chemicals can strip hair of natural oils.
-
Wet your hair: Start by thoroughly wetting your hair with warm water. This helps open the hair cuticles and prepares your scalp for cleansing.
-
Apply the shampoo: Use a quarter-sized amount of stinging nettle shampoo. Gently massage it onto your scalp using your fingertips. This stimulates blood circulation and ensures that the shampoo reaches the roots of your hair.
-
Leave it in: Allow the shampoo to sit for 2-3 minutes. This gives the active ingredients time to penetrate the hair follicles. Stinging nettle is known for its rich content of vitamins A and C, which support hair growth.
-
Rinse thoroughly: Rinse your hair with lukewarm water. Ensure all shampoo is removed from your hair to prevent buildup and irritation on the scalp.
-
Condition: Follow up with a nourishing conditioner. A conditioner will provide moisture and lock in the benefits of the stinging nettle shampoo. Use a lightweight formula that won’t weigh down your hair.
-
Frequency of use: Use stinging nettle shampoo 2-3 times a week for optimal results. Using it too often may lead to dryness, as the natural oils can be stripped away.
-
Monitor your hair and scalp: Observe how your hair and scalp respond to the shampoo over time. Adjust usage if you experience any irritation or dryness.
Stinging nettle shampoo can support overall hair health. According to a study published in the Journal of Ethnopharmacology (López et al., 2010), stinging nettle is effective in promoting hair growth and reducing hair loss due to its rich nutrient profile and anti-inflammatory properties. Regular use can lead to healthier, fuller hair.
What Alternative Hair Loss Remedies Work Well with Stinging Nettle Shampoo for Optimal Results?
Stinging nettle shampoo can be effectively combined with several alternative hair loss remedies for optimal results. The following remedies may enhance the effectiveness of stinging nettle shampoo:
- Saw Palmetto
- Pumpkin Seed Oil
- Biotin Supplements
- Essential Oils (e.g., rosemary, peppermint)
- Balanced Diet Rich in Vitamins and Minerals
- Scalp Massage
- Aloe Vera
- Stress Management Techniques
These remedies provide various approaches to tackle hair loss, integrating topical and dietary strategies while considering personal preferences and needs.
-
Saw Palmetto: Saw palmetto is a plant extract known for its ability to block the formation of dihydrotestosterone (DHT), a hormone linked to hair loss. A study published in the Journal of Alternative and Complementary Medicine found that saw palmetto may effectively reduce hair thinning in men and women. The American Botanical Council notes its long usage as a natural remedy for promoting hair health.
-
Pumpkin Seed Oil: Pumpkin seed oil is rich in essential fatty acids and antioxidants, which may support hair growth. Research from 2014 indicated that a daily intake of pumpkin seed oil led to an increase in hair count in men with androgenetic alopecia. This oil can be used topically or taken as a supplement to encourage hair vitality.
-
Biotin Supplements: Biotin is a B vitamin essential for healthy hair growth. A study by Elmets et al. (2017) highlighted biotin’s potential role in treating hair loss disorders. Biotin strengthens hair structure and improves hair health, making it a popular choice amongst those seeking to support their hair growth regimen.
-
Essential Oils (e.g., rosemary, peppermint): Essential oils have been shown to promote hair growth and improve scalp health. Research indicates that rosemary oil can enhance hair regrowth in people with androgenetic alopecia. An article in Archives of Dermatology discussed how peppermint oil may stimulate hair follicles and increase circulation to the scalp.
-
Balanced Diet Rich in Vitamins and Minerals: A diet filled with vitamins such as A, C, D, E, and minerals like zinc and iron can profoundly impact hair health. Nutritional deficiencies can lead to hair loss. According to a study in the Journal of Dermatology, nutrients like omega-3 fatty acids also support hair growth.
-
Scalp Massage: Scalp massage improves blood circulation in the scalp, which may promote hair growth. A 2016 study published in Evidenced-Based Complementary and Alternative Medicine found that regular scalp massages increased hair density in participants after 24 weeks.
-
Aloe Vera: Aloe vera has soothing and anti-inflammatory properties. It can help reduce dandruff and unblock hair follicles. According to a study in the International Journal of Research in Pharmaceutical Sciences, aloe vera promotes hair growth by reducing scalp irritation and can be applied as a gel or supplement.
-
Stress Management Techniques: Chronic stress is known to cause hair loss. Techniques such as yoga, meditation, and regular physical activity help manage stress levels. The American Psychological Association emphasizes that reducing stress can significantly impact overall health, including hair health, as stress hormones can inhibit hair growth.
